This semi-detached house on Norton Road in Pelsall, Walsall WS3 4NU, was built between 1950-1966. The property has a floor area of 88 square metres and is fully double-glazed. It has a current energy rating of 'C' and an estimated potential energy rating of 'B'. The property consumes 217 units of energy per year and has a running cost of £892. The heating system is a mains gas boiler with a programmer, room thermostat, and TRVs. The roof has 270mm of loft insulation. The current CO2 emission is 3.3 and the potential is 1.4. The property is not in a flood risk area. This property has not been sold in recent records.
